Output 1668577554cc37cbe20bdd2e26d7eb6a8a7cddf3823db25dfc1ada45735c965f:2

value
5420886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3306b8e3cbc4fc8eb49cd4bada69bc79d7a445f0 OP_EQUALVERIFY OP_CHECKSIG
address
15eoWrQSLc4Lpp3TaiHf16m8wYSEe65dM8
transaction
1668577554cc37cbe20bdd2e26d7eb6a8a7cddf3823db25dfc1ada45735c965f
spent
true